Transaction 2fd8c56abc6e3926c701a289a22a1828d08b0c39c9ef5537eee944aa0acb2c1e
1 Input
1 Output
-
2fd8c56abc6e3926c701a289a22a1828d08b0c39c9ef5537eee944aa0acb2c1e:0
- value
- 3498969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8a56a1f93615098aa31aa79688e97c7b8df9deb OP_EQUAL
- address
- 3Nu8rFbTYDZmL95YdoBwc4GJAMTbdUmfpd